    See, I've played the Pokemon games on and off since the first ones, but the last one to really grab me was Gold version. I sunk an inordinate amount of time into that game, along with the first ones, and I fucking loved every second of it. I have a soft spot in my heart for Pokemon, I just haven't been able to feel it much since then.

    That's where Pokemon X comes in. This game has totally grabbed me, and I can't exactly put my finger on why. Maybe it's the significantly faster character movement, or the new graphical style. Maybe it has something to do with the relatively small number of new Pokemon in this title, leading to less uninspired crap. Maybe it's the new type addition, completely messing with the age-old type chart in a way they haven't done since Gold/Silver.

    Those all seem like relatively minor changes though, right? I'm not quite sure how this game has managed to get its hooks into me so deep. I've sunk 105 hours into it since Christmas. That's completely insane.

    Well, my inability to understand my love for it aside, the game is fucking great, and it's definitely the best one the series has offered in a long time. If you have a passing interest or curiosity about Pokemon, I'd say you should definitely pick this one up.
